Daredevil #32 (644)
In "Lockdown Part 2," Matt Murdock is trapped in a prison where every inmate is a threat, forcing him to fight his way through a deadly gauntlet to take down the warden. Meanwhile, Bullseye’s escalating rampage through the city takes a chilling turn when Elektra confronts him—only to discover he’s not alone, as multiple versions of him have been operating in secret. Written by Chip Zdarsky and illustrated by Mike Hawthorne, with inks by Adriano Di Benedetto, colors by Marcio Menyz, and letters by VC's Clayton Cowles, this issue delivers intense, high-stakes action with a haunting twist. The cover, by Marco Checchetto, captures the tension in a striking, shadow-drenched image.

Matt finds that he has to fight everyone in the prison to bring down the warden. Bullseye's body count rises rapidly, terrorizing the city, but when Elektra confronts him, she is shocked to see that he has been cloned, and several Bullseyes have been working together.
